Hi Everyone,

 

I just got a new computer yesterday (Pavilion gaming 16GB with windows 10) and I am in the process of installing Origin. 

 

However when I try to download it from the website and launch the originthinsteup exe. it comes up with an error and then MSVCP140.dll not being found? 

 

I did some research to see how to fix this problem and that the best approach is to open up the local C drive and access origin from there via  but that file is not there at all because it cannot even be installed. (E.T.C x 86 or x64). 

 

I'm a bit stumped, not sure if its a origin issue or Microsoft program issue.

 

Any Ideas you have would be great!

Re: ERROR MSVCP140.dll, SETTING UP ORIGIN ON WINDOWS 10

@JupiterFalls97 and @ThriceDamned  That file is part of the 2015 VC++ runtimes, which Origin needs to install properly.  It's best to uninstall your current copies, if you have any, and then download new ones from Microsoft.  Hit Windows key-i, select Apps, scroll down to Microsoft Visual C++ 2015 Redistributable, click on both the x86 and x64 entries (if you have them), and select Uninstall.  You can download new copies here. Be sure to install both the x86 and x64 versions.

 

https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/download/details.aspx?id=48145

 

Restart your computer, and try to install Origin again.

Be sure to install both the x86 and x64 versions.

 

THIS is key! I installed just the x64 version first, and it still wasn't working. But after installing the x86 version too, it is working. Thank you!
